> This series implement two new operations for plugins:
> - Store inline allows to write a specific value to a scoreboard.
> - Conditional callback executes a callback only when a given condition is true.
> The condition is evaluated inline.
>
> It's possible to mix various inline operations (add, store) with conditional
> callbacks, allowing efficient "trap" based counters.
>
> It builds on top of new scoreboard API, introduced in the previous series.
